Responsibilities

  • MicroStrategy Related ResponsibilitiesMetadata creation (Code review with team members)Subscription supportMSTR Security administrationTroubleshooting end user issues
  • Data Analytics responsibilitiesCreating stored procedures, views, triggers using SQL
  • Dashboard / Dossier development Using MicroStrategy and PowerBI or the like

Qualifications

  • 3-5 years of SQL experienceCreating stored procedures, views, triggersGood understanding of relational database design
  • 3-5 years of Data Analysis / ReportingPower BIMicroStrategy (preferred)
  • Dashboard / Dossier development skills
  • Willingness to learn
  • Attention to detail
  • Good communication skills
